i love that ep, made my top ten of last year. they're from montreal, friends with arcade fire ect... isaac brock loves them, had them open up for him, and then got them signed to sub pop. they're finishing up their debut, which will be out sometime this summer. i'm super excited for it, they have the potential to make a great record.

I saw them open for Modest Mouse in Montreal last year. They put on a very good show, I had never heard of them but was impressed enough to buy both EPs that were for sale at the show. I liked them live better than on disc; the discs are very thin sounding and did not capture their live sound well at all. Hopefully once their fist full-length is released the sound will be better. Apparently Isaac Brock is producing them.

The most impressive part of their live set was the lead singer/guitarist. A very intense passionate performer who has big things ahead of him, I think.
